ALBANY AVENUE SCHOOL is a K-5 school of mid-tier scale in LINDENHURST, New York, run under LINDENHURST UNION FREE SCHOOL DISTRICT, hosting 498 students in grades K through 5.
ALBANY AVENUE SCHOOL is one of 8 schools operated by LINDENHURST UNION FREE SCHOOL DISTRICT, a district that educates 5,560 students overall.
On the student-mix side, ALBANY AVENUE SCHOOL records that the largest single group is Hispanic at 51%, but no single group is in the majority. Other groups include 40% White, 5% Asian, 3% Black. By comparison, Suffolk County as a whole is about 23% Hispanic, so the school skews considerably more Hispanic than its surroundings.
On the resource side, ALBANY AVENUE SCHOOL shows 46 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 10.8:1. That figure is tighter than the state norm's 12.8:1 average. Roughly 45% of students at ALBANY AVENUE SCHOOL q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, often used as a Title I proxy.
Adjusting for the school's free-and-reduced-lunch share, ALBANY AVENUE SCHOOL tracks the demographic baseline. The model predicts 58.3% given the school's FRL share; actual proficiency is 51.2%.
Around the school, census data for Suffolk County shows median household earnings sit near $130,686, about 40%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and the poverty rate sits near 4%. Across Suffolk County's 343 public schools (combined enrollment of about 222,439 students), ALBANY AVENUE SCHOOL is one campus in the mix.
The closest other public school is WEST GATES AVENUE SCHOOL, roughly 0.5 miles away.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ools. Ranking that nearby cluster on reported proficiency puts ALBANY AVENUE SCHOOL at 3rd of 9; the average score across the group is 47.0%.
The school occupies an outer-ring site.
Five-year trend. ALBANY AVENUE SCHOOL's enrollment has grew 19% since 2018, when it stood at 419 (now 498). White enrollment moved from 64% to 40% across the same window. The student-to-teacher ratio narrowed from 14.0:1 in 2018 to 10.8:1 today.
